DEGW Foundation Lecture

10 October 2018
18:30 - 20:00
Room G01, building L022, London Road campus

Work and the future office/Work and the city

The School of the Built Environment hosted its DEGW Foundation Lecture on Wednesday 10 October, together with a special viewing of the DEGW archive.

This year's exciting programme comprised the themes of 'Work and the future office' led by Nicola Gillen, Director and Global Practice Leader Strategy+ at AECOM and 'Work in the city: Direction for change' featuring Andrew Laing PhD, Principal of Andrew Laing Consulting LLC, and Visiting Lecturer at Princeton University, School of Architecture.
